在Ubuntu中使用QEMU运行虚拟机
为什么选择QEMU作为虚拟机运行工具?
QEMU是一个功能强大的模拟器和虚拟机,能够模拟整个计算机系统,包括处理器、内存、磁盘设备以及网络设备等。在Ubuntu中,我们可以利用QEMU来创建和运行虚拟机,实现在一个操作系统中同时运行多个不同操作系统的需求。
如何安装QEMU及相关工具?
在Ubuntu中,通过apt包管理器可以轻松安装QEMU及其相关工具。打开终端,输入相应命令即可完成安装过程。
如何启动虚拟机?
使用QEMU启动虚拟机时,可以通过命令行参数灵活配置虚拟机,设置CPU个数、内存大小、磁盘镜像文件、网络信息等。下面是简单启动虚拟机的示例命令。
如何管理虚拟机?
除了手动操作外,还可以利用virsh工具来管理虚拟机,通过定义虚拟机配置文件和使用相应命令来注册和控制虚拟机的运行。
相关问题与解答
Q1: 如何查看QEMU支持的可用CPU模型?
A1: 使用qemu-system-x86_64 --cpu-models
命令可以列出所有支持的CPU模型。
Q2: QEMU是否支持图形界面?
A2: 是的,QEMU支持图形界面,可以通过命令行参数指定图形显示服务器的地址和端口。
Q3: 如何在QEMU中设置虚拟机的网络?
A3: QEMU支持多种网络模式,包括用户模式网络、桥接网络和NAT网络,可通过-net
参数设置。
Q4: 如何将虚拟机的串口重定向到宿主机?
A4: 可以通过-serial
参数设置串口重定向,例如-serial stdio
可实现串口重定向到标准输入输出。
感谢您阅读本文,如果有任何疑问或想了解更多相关内容,请留言评论。同时,欢迎关注我们的更新并点赞支持,谢谢!
评论留言